Managing import logistics and VAT in the Netherlands
Shipping electronics to the Netherlands requires compliance with the Belastingdienst (Dutch Tax and Customs Administration). All items imported from outside the European Union are subject to a 21% BTW (VAT). While the US retail price is lower, you must account for this tax upon the item's arrival in the Netherlands. The use of a professional international shipping provider ensures that all necessary customs documentation is handled correctly, preventing unnecessary delays at Schiphol or other ports of entry.
